London South East Academies Trust is a Multi-Academy Trust established in 2014.
Its family of schools currently include mainstream, special and alternative provision academies located across Bromley, Bexley, Lambeth, Surrey and East Sussex.
The Trust is tendering its catering services with a contract start date of 1st August 2026.
The initial term will run for three years, ending on 31st July 2029, with a requirement for termly and annual reviews and a break clause to support both parties should the relationship not prosper.
There will be an option to extend for up to two further years (1+1) by mutual agreement, based on qualitative and financial performance.
The contract will be divided into three separate lots and bidders have the opportunity to bid for one, multiple or all lots, depending on their operational capacity and expertise. • Lot 1 – Mainstream, Alternative Provision and Social, Emotional and Mental Health (SEMH) Schools • Lot 2 – High-level SEND Provision • Lot 3 – Delivered-in hot meal service The Trust is seeking a professional catering contractor who can deliver an excellent level of service, high-quality food and service enhancements, realistic and achievable sales targets and ongoing support to the Trust’s communities throughout the contract.
The projected turnover for the three-year contract is expected to be circa: Lot 1 - £4,678,434 Lot 2 - £538,537 Lot 3 - £131,382 The Trust is running this procurement as a Competitive Flexible, Two Stage, Light Touch Regime Tender Process.

In short, the Trust needs to be convinced that bidders can deliver their promises in full, achieve their sales projections, and meet their service enhancements.
If the Trust is not convinced of this, it reserves the right to consider an insourced solution or make no award.
Any investment proposals must align with DfE guidelines.
